EASTERN WAUKESHA AND KENOSHA COUNTIES THROUGH 715 AM CDT... At 630 AM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king strong thunderstorms along a line extending from Glendale to near Walworth. Movement was east at 40 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 40 mph and half inch h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is possible. Locations impacted include... Milwaukee, Kenosha, Racine, Waukesha, West Allis, Wauwatosa, New Berlin, Brookfield, Greenfield, Menomonee Falls, Oak Creek, Mount Pleasant, Muskego, South Milwaukee, Pleasant Prairie, Cudahy, Antioch, Whitefish Bay, Greendale, and Pewaukee.
